    <description>The Tribunal upheld the AAC&#039;s decision in favor of the assessee, allowing the carry forward and set off of the loss from a previous year determined in the firms&#039; files but not in the assessee&#039;s own file. The Tribunal emphasized that the assessee had fulfilled all necessary procedures and cited relevant case law to support the decision. The Department&#039;s argument that only losses determined by the ITO could be carried forward was rejected, and the Tribunal affirmed that the right to carry forward losses is not dependent on quantification in the assessee&#039;s file. The Department&#039;s appeal was dismissed.</description>
